Transaction 238bec78144caedda0321a63d967415dce84c8944591a3544cdcdc54ec135182

2 Input
2 Outputs
  • 238bec78144caedda0321a63d967415dce84c8944591a3544cdcdc54ec135182:0
  • value  40409
    address  1FV7PshkpFHUSqZsgzAvuq8buuRrCRqH8Y
  • 238bec78144caedda0321a63d967415dce84c8944591a3544cdcdc54ec135182:1
  • value  961348
    address  32tMDHppNUWKArtXSVdv3i9ZzzceXdMyme